The Summation Showstopper

Now, let's talk about sums. The sum of the first n positive odd integers is a pattern in itself. It's given by the formula n^2. For instance, the sum of the first 5 positive odd integers (1 + 3 + 5 + 7 + 9) is 25, which is 5 squared. Isn't that neat?
